With the subscription for the last two days completed, the Law School Year Book Committee settled back to observe their work with contentment. For final figures revealed yesterday that 1203 students out of 1385 enrolled have subscribed.
Approximately 800 of these signed for the book, the first of its kind published, at registration time, and the rest of the subscriptions were obtained during the drive.
The Year Book, scheduled to appear sometime in the first two weeks of November, will contain pictures of all law students, together with the college they attended, and their local address.
In addition there will be pictured and biographies of all members of the Faculty, pictures of the Ames Competition.
